Army Research Office and Air Force Office of Scientific Research; 1998 Contractors' Meeting in Chemical Propulsion Held in Long Beach, California on 29 June-1 July 1998

Abstract

Partial contents: AFOSR Sponsored Research in Combustion and Diagnostics; Intelligent Turbine Engines; Analysis of Advanced Direct-Injection Diesel Engine Development Strategies; Visualization of High-Power-Density Diesel Engine Combustion; Development of a Laser-Induced Fluorescence Technique for Characterization of Reaction Zones; Advanced Diagnostics for Reacting Flows; Resonant Holographic Interferometry, An innovative Technique for Combustion Diagnostics; Numerical Modelling of Two-Phase Nozzle Flows; Fluorescent Diagnostics and Fundamental Approaches to Droplet, Spray, Engine, and Aerodynamic Behavior; The Evaporation of Liquid Droplets in Highly Turbulent Gas Streams; The Effect of Turbulence on Droplet Drag, Dispersion, Vaporization and Secondary Breakup in Diesel Fuel Sprays.
